Historical Evolution
The history of windows and doors go back to ancient civilizations. Early doors were basic structures made from animal hides or tree branches, developed mostly to secure occupants from the components and burglars. Windows, on the other hand, were at first small openings in walls, frequently covered with animal hides or wooden shutters to manage light and air.

As civilizations advanced, so did the products and styles of doors and windows. The ancient Egyptians and Greeks used stone and wood, while the Romans presented the use of glass in windows. During the Middle Ages, wooden doors and windows became more sophisticated, with detailed carvings and stained glass. The Industrial Revolution brought substantial improvements, introducing mass-produced glass and metal doors, which were more budget friendly and long lasting.
In the 20th and 21st centuries, technological innovations have actually caused the development of energy-efficient windows and clever Doors & windows, integrating functions like automatic locking and remote control. Modern materials like vinyl, aluminum, and composite wood have likewise ended up being popular due to their resilience and low upkeep.
Types of Doors and Windows
Doors
Entry Doors
- Wood Doors: Classic and flexible, wooden doors offer outstanding insulation and can be personalized with various finishes.
- Steel Doors: Known for their strength and security, steel doors are often used in high-risk areas.
- Fiberglass Doors: Combining the durability of steel with the visual appeal of wood, fiberglass doors are resistant to warping and rotting.
- Glass Doors: Ideal for contemporary designs, glass doors enable natural light and can be reinforced for security.
Interior Doors
- Hinged Doors: The most common type, hinged doors are connected to the frame with hinges and can open inward or outside.
- Moving Doors: Space-efficient and easy to utilize, moving doors slide along a track and are typically utilized in closets and outdoor patios.
- Bifold Doors: These doors fold back on themselves, creating a bigger opening and are popular in little spaces.
- Pocket Doors: Hidden within the wall, pocket doors are ideal for small rooms where floor area is restricted.
Specialized Doors
- french doors and side windows Doors: Consisting of numerous glass panes, French doors use a lovely and functional entryway.
- Biometric Doors: Equipped with finger print or facial acknowledgment innovation, these doors supply enhanced security.
- Fireproof Doors: Designed to hold up against high temperature levels and slow the spread of fire, these doors are required in certain structure codes.
Windows
Single-Hung Windows
- One sash is fixed, while the other can move up or down. They are easy to run and tidy.
Double-Hung windows and doors aluminium
- Both sashes can move up and down, providing better ventilation and easier cleaning.
Casement Windows
- Depended upon one side and open external, casement windows are ideal for cross-ventilation and can be safely closed.
Awning Windows
- Comparable to casement windows but hinged at the leading, awning windows are perfect for rainy weather condition as they can be exposed without water getting in the room.
Sliding Windows
- Several sashes slide horizontally, making them space-efficient and easy to run.
Bay and Bow Windows
- These windows extend external from the wall, developing additional space and a panoramic view.
Skylights
- Set up in the roof, skylights enable natural light to flood the space and are often utilized in bathrooms and corridors.

Elements to Consider When Choosing Doors and Windows
Product
- Wood: Durable and personalized, but needs routine upkeep.
- Vinyl: Low maintenance and inexpensive, however may not provide the exact same resilience as wood or metal.
- Aluminum: Strong and resistant to corrosion, suitable for coastal locations.
- Composite: Combines the benefits of multiple products, using sturdiness and low upkeep.
Energy Efficiency
- Look for doors and windows with an Energy Star score, which ensures high energy efficiency.
- Consider the U-factor (rate of heat transfer) and R-value (resistance to heat circulation) when choosing materials.
Style and Design
- Select styles that complement the architectural design of your building.
- Customization options can assist attain the wanted appearance and functionality.
Security
- Buy top quality locks and security functions, specifically for entry doors and ground-floor windows.
- Consider including security screens or impact-resistant glass for added defense.
Spending plan
- Determine your budget and look for options that provide the best worth for cash.
- High-quality materials and functions can be more pricey however typically supply long-term benefits.

FAQs
What is the distinction in between single-hung and double-hung windows?
- Single-hung windows have one sash that can slide up or down, while double-hung windows have two sashes that can both move up and down. Double-hung windows offer much better ventilation and are simpler to clean.
How can I enhance the energy effectiveness of my existing windows?
- Set up weatherstripping and caulking to seal air leaks.
- Use window movies or low-E coverings to show heat.
- Add heavy drapes or blinds to supply extra insulation.
What are the best products for exterior doors?
- Steel and fiberglass are outstanding choices for exterior doors due to their toughness and security functions. They likewise offer low maintenance and good insulation.
How frequently should I replace my windows and doors?
- Windows and doors typically last 15-20 years with proper maintenance. However, if you discover indications of wear, such as drafts, difficulty in operation, or damage, it may be time for a replacement.
Can I set up doors and windows myself?
- While it is possible to set up some types of windows and doors yourself, it is usually advised to hire an expert. Correct installation guarantees the best efficiency and energy performance.
